AMN Healthcare currently has 1 Computed Tomography Technology job available in Wilson, with start dates as early as 12/18/25. As of December 4, 2025, the average weekly pay for a CT Tech in Wilson was $2,177, with the range in pay between $2,078 and $2,277.

If you’re a CT Tech curious about Travel job trends in Wilson, NC,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 17 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,940 and a range from $1,604 to $2,318 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.
Positions were located in key zip codes, including 27893.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led CT Techs in Wilson’s thriving healthcare landscape. As a CT Technologist working in Wilson, North Carolina, you can expect a diverse range of opportunities within various healthcare facilities, including hospitals, outpatient imaging centers, and specialty clinics. In these settings, you will perform advanced imaging procedures utilizing computed tomography to assist in the diagnosis and treatment of patients with varying medical conditions. You will collaborate with radiologists and other healthcare professionals to ensure high-quality imaging results, while also participating in patient care activities, such as preparing patients for scans, explaining procedures, and ensuring their comfort throughout the process. As a CT Technologist considering a travel opportunity in Wilson, North Carolina, you’ll discover a charming small-town atmosphere with the perks of nearby city life in Raleigh and Greenville. Wilson boasts a temperate climate, with mild winters and warm summers, making it an ideal location for outdoor enthusiasts year-round. You can explore popular neighborhoods like the historic downtown area, which is filled with delightful shops, local eateries, and the beautifully landscaped Wilson Rose Garden. Enjoy weekends filled with cultural experiences, from visiting the Hands On! Museum for Children to enjoying local festivities such as the annual Whirligig Festival. Plus, the nearby recreational areas offer excellent options for hiking, biking, and relaxation, ensuring that your time in Wilson will be as fulfilling off the clock as it is on it.

For a Computed Tomography Technology travel job in Wilson, North Carolina, candidates typically need a valid ARRT certification in CT along with relevant clinical experience in the field. Additionally, familiarity with various imaging modalities and strong patient care skills are often preferred by employers to ensure high-quality service delivery.
In Wilson, North Carolina, Computed Tomography Technology travel jobs are typically offered at hospitals, outpatient imaging centers, and specialized diagnostic facilities. These settings provide opportunities to work in diverse clinical environments while utilizing advanced imaging technology.
For Computed Tomography Technology Travel jobs in Wilson, NC, typical contract durations range from 13 weeks. These flexible contract lengths allow you to choose an assignment that best fits your career goals and lifestyle preferences.
